Global markets were mixed in early trading a day after China announced a major stimulus program.
S&P 500 Futures: 5,782.25 ⬇️ down 0.17%
S&P 500: 5,732.93...
(Bloomberg) -- US stock futures ticked lower after the S&P 500 finished with its 41st record close this year. Treasuries and the dollar steadied.Most...